College roundup: Fisher leads BC into COS tourney final

VISALIA Bobby Fisher finished with 18 points and 10 rebounds as the Bakersfield College men's basketball team defeated Fresno City College 76-69 in the semifinals of the College of the Sequoias Tournament.

Chase Adams also contributed 15 points and Stevie Howard had 4 steals for the Renegades (10-2). With the win Bakersfield College advances to the finals today at 4 p.m.

JC WOMEN'S BASKETBALL

Dominique Scott scored 31 points and grabbed 12 rebounds to lead Pasadena City College past Bakersfield College 82-60 in a non-conference game in Pasadena.

Scott scored 18 of her points in the first half for the Lancers (11-2).

The Renegades (4-6) were led by Alexi Smith, who scored 22 points and grabbed a game-high 16 rebounds. Kaileigh Christensen added 13 points and 11 rebounds.

SWIMMING

Jake Priest, Keenan Natyzak and Matt Parsonage helped the Cal State Bakersfield men's swim team dominate four-time defending NAIA National Champion Cal Baptist in a 170-119 win at Loyola Marymount.

Priest won the 200 fly (1:54.50), 200 breast (2:11.65) and the 200 IM (1:56.01). Natyzak won the 200 free (1:41.48) and 500 free (4:40.86). Parsonage won the 100 breast (58.88) and 50 free (21.58).

The CSUB women's swim team split a pair of dual competitions, claiming a 172-127 win over Cal Baptist and dropping a 166-121 score to host Loyola Marymount.

Stephanie Donnelly won the 100 back (1:00.98), Rachel McCall took first in the 100 breast (1:06.69) and Rachel Holm won the 200 breast.

CSUB Hannah Yoder took first in the one-meter event and Victoria Kreutz won the three-meter event held at UCLA.
